Product Description of ProSoft MVI69-HART

MVI69-HART is a dual-channel HART master station communication module specially designed by ProSoft for the Rockwell CompactLogix/MicroLogix platform. Through two independent HART master station interfaces, it directly connects and manages HART intelligent instruments (pressure, temperature, flow, level transmitters). By superimposing digital communication on the 4-20mA analog signal, it realizes process variable acquisition, equipment configuration, diagnosis and calibration, and is a standard solution for integrating HART devices in process automation systems.

I. Model Analysis

MVI69: Specialized module for CompactLogix 1769 platform

HART: Highway Addressable Remote Transducer (High-speed Channel for Addressable Remote Sensors)

Core Positioning: Dual-channel HART master station, Bell 202 FSK, multi-point networking, analog + digital dual transmission, industrial-level isolation, single-slot installation

II. Core Hardware Specifications

Compatible Platforms: Full series of CompactLogix (L1x–L7x, excluding L16x/L18x/QBFC1B), MicroLogix 1500 LRP, 1769 I/O bus, single-slot installation

Backplane Power Consumption: Maximum 800mA @ 5.1VDC

HART Interface

Channels: 2 independent HART master stations

Protocols: HART protocol (Bell 202 FSK), compatible with HART 5/6/7 versions

Physical Layer: 2-wire 4-20mA current loop, FSK digital signal superimposition

Node Capacity: Up to 15 slave devices per port (multi-point mode)

Electrical Isolation: 1500Vrms optical isolation

Communication Rate: 1200 bps (HART standard)

Data Buffer: 4000 bytes bidirectional database, mapped to PLC controller tag

LED Status: OK, BP, CH1, CH2, ERR five groups of indicator lights

Operating Environment

Temperature: 0°C ~ +60°C

Storage: -40°C ~ +85°C

Humidity: 5% ~ 95% (no condensation)

Certifications: CE, UL, cURus, RoHS, Class 1 Div 2 Hazardous Area Certification

III. Core Functions and Performance

1. HART Master Station Communication (Core Advantage)

Dual-channel Independent HART Master Station

Two channels are completely independent and can operate simultaneously in point-to-point (direct connection to a single instrument) or multi-point (bus connection to multiple devices) mode

Active polling of all HART slave stations, automatic discovery of devices, reading of variables, status and diagnostics

Support for HART general commands (reading PV, SV, TV, FV process variables) and specific device commands

Configurable as Hand Controller mode, directly configuring, calibrating, and modifying parameters for the instrument

Analog + Digital Dual Signal Transmission

4-20mA Analog Signal: Transmits main process variables (PV)

FSK Digital Signal: Superimposes transmission of multiple variables, device status, diagnostic codes, configuration parameters

No need to modify existing wiring: Compatible with traditional 4-20mA circuits, smooth upgrade of intelligent functions

Automatic Data Acquisition and Processing

Module independently automatically polls, zero PLC CPU load

Supports periodic / triggered data updates

Real-time parsing of HART data, conversion to PLC standard tags

Built-in data cache to ensure communication stability

2. Seamless Integration with PLC System

High-speed Backplane Data Exchange

Module directly mapped as an I/O module to the PLC controller tag

Provides AOI (Add-On Instruction) and example programs to simplify development

All data, status, and diagnostic information is visible in the PLC program in real time

Configuration files are automatically saved to the PLC project

Deep integration with Studio 5000

Support for RSLogix 5000 / Studio 5000 configuration environment

Module status, channel status, device diagnostics, error codes are monitored in real time By using ladder diagrams, HART commands can be sent, parameters can be written, and equipment calibration can be performed.

3. Industrial-grade reliability and maintenance

Full electrical isolation protection

1500Vrms isolation: Anti-surge, anti-static, elimination of ground potential difference, protecting PLC and field instruments

Powerful diagnostic function

Real-time monitoring: Loop status, communication quality, equipment failure, signal quality

Support for HART device diagnostic status (such as sensor failure, exceeding range, calibration error)

Detailed error codes and event logs, quick fault location
